IMPLEMENTATION SUPPORT OFFICER I - TREASURY MANAGEMENT WHAT IS THE OPPORTUNITY? This position is responsible for the implementation and ongoing maintenance of new Treasury Management services following the close of sale through initial client product usage
Ensure products are properly set up in accordance with published service level agreements, provides implementation support to the TM Sales Officer and line unit personnel by providing and recommending the appropriate process for implementing a product
What you will do Receive, review, and process the product setup paperwork according to policy and procedure
Activities generally include, but are not limited to, reviewing implementation packages for accuracy and completeness, follow-up on missing documentation, disbursing paperwork to Implementation Operations, preparing implementation status reports and summaries, communicating set up status to sales officers and field officers and acting as liaison between Treasury Management and other business units
Assist both internal and external clients with product and implementation questions
Provides support to clients concerning product usage and functionality
Maintain positive relationships with all units within the bank by providing product/service informational support, timely and accurate implementation of requests, detailed tracking, follow-up and communication on all Treasury Management products and services
Maintain a proactive commitment to established Bank programs, such as CustomerFirst, Community Reinvestment Act (CRA) and Equal Employment Opportunity
Comply fully with all Bank Operational and Credit policies and procedures as well as all regulatory requirements (e.g
Bank Secrecy Act, Know Your Client, Community Reinvestment Act, Fair Lending Practices, Code of Conduct, etc.)
Must-Have* Minimum 2 years in banking environment or financial institution Minimum 1 year experience in Treasury/Cash Management Minimum 1 year experience working with PC based software applications
Skills and Knowledge Preferred degree from a four year college or university with concentration in a discipline directly related to the financial services industry or equivalent job experience
Sufficient experience in the banking industry showing an understanding of basic banking operations and treasury management processes
Proficient in the use of network and PC based software applications including menu driven work processing, spreadsheet, database, and information reporting software
Strong written and verbal communications skills
Ability to gather, arranges, compile, interpret, analyze, summarize and evaluate information and data to formulate conclusions and recommended actions
